Kane Area Hs is a mid-sized high school in Kane, Pennsylvania, enrolling 282 students.
Classes run notably small here: at 10.1:1, Kane Area Hs is leaner than roughly 91% of Pennsylvania schools and 26% under the state's 13.6:1 norm, more adult attention per pupil than most peers.
Its free-meal eligibility rate of 42.2% lands close to the Pennsylvania typical range, neither a high- nor low-need campus by this measure.
Enrollment of 282 puts it in the smaller third of Pennsylvania schools by headcount.
Its Resource Investment Index lands in the upper third of 2,889 scored Pennsylvania schools.
Against 379 statewide peers matched on enrollment and economic need, it ranks mid-pack at #170.
Its student body is predominantly White (95% of enrollment), among the less diverse in the state (diversity index 10/100).
On the academic-pipeline side it reports 4 Advanced Placement courses.
Counselor coverage runs a bit thin, about 282 students per counselor, somewhat past the ASCA-recommended 250:1 benchmark.
Chronic absenteeism is elevated: 26.6% of students missed 10% or more of school days (2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ection).
The federal civil-rights collection also records 2 expulsions at this campus for 2021-22.
Kane Area Sd also operates Kane Area El Sch (405 students) and Kane Area Ms (218 students) alongside Kane Area Hs.
